Steven Paul Duke was a 2012 Green Party candidate who sought election to the U.S. House representing the 11th Congressional District of Michigan.

Elections

2012

See also: Michigan's 11th congressional district elections, 2012

Duke was defeated by republican Kerry Bentivolio.[1] Duke ran in the 2012 election for the U.S. House, representing Michigan's 11th District. Duke ran as a Green Party candidate. He faced Kerry Bentivolio (R), John Tatar (L), Syed Taj (D), and Daniel Johnson (NLP) in the general election on November 6, 2012.[2]

U.S. House, Michigan, District 11 General Election, 2012
Party Candidate Vote % Votes
     Democratic Syed Taj 44.4% 158,879
     Republican Green check mark.jpgKerry Bentivolio 50.8% 181,788
     Libertarian John Tatar 2.7% 9,637
     Green Steven Paul Duke 1.3% 4,569
     NLP Daniel Johnson 0.9% 3,251
Total Votes 358,124
Source: Michigan Secretary of State "Official Election Results, 2012 General Election"
